The serial position effect is a cognitive phenomenon where individuals are more likely to recall the first and last items in a list compared to those in the middle. This effect is divided into the primacy effect and the recency effect. The primacy effect is observed when the initial items in a list are remembered better. Language serves as a bridge between ideas and communication, influencing how individuals perceive and interact with the world. Psychologists have long debated whether language shapes thought or vice versa. This discussion gained grip with Edward Sapir and Benjamin Lee Whorf in the 1940s, who proposed that language determines thought, a concept known as linguistic determinism. They suggested that the vocabulary and structure of a language influence how its speakers think and perceive reality.

PURE ALEXIA AND THE VIEWING POSITION EFFECT IN PRINTED WORDS.

Marie Montant, Tatjana A Nazir, Michel Poncet

    Cognitive Neuropsychology
    |June 29, 2017
    PubMed
    Summary

    This study examined pure alexic patient CP's reading, finding their optimal word recognition occurred when fixating the right word half, unlike normal readers. This suggests a visual processing deficit impacting letter recognition.

    Area of Science:

    • Cognitive Neuroscience
    • Psychology
    • Linguistics

    Background:

    • The viewing position effect describes how word recognition varies with eye fixation location.
    • Normal readers exhibit optimal recognition when fixating slightly left of a word's center.
    • Pure alexia is a reading disorder characterized by difficulty recognizing words.

    Purpose of the Study:

    • To investigate the reading abilities of a pure alexic patient (CP).
    • To compare CP's viewing position effect with that of normal readers.
    • To elucidate the underlying mechanisms of CP's reading impairment.

    Main Methods:

    • Utilized an experimental paradigm to elicit the viewing position effect.
    • Applied a mathematical model (Nazir, O'Regan, & Jacobs, 1991) to quantify reading performance.

  • Tested CP and normal readers under varying lexical knowledge constraints.
  • Main Results:

    • CP processed all letters within a single fixation, similar to normal readers.
    • CP's optimal reading performance occurred when fixating the right word half.
    • CP exhibited poor perceptual processing in the right visual field and difficulty with word-final letters.

    Conclusions:

    • CP's reading impairment may stem from a coupling dysfunction between visual input and lexical information.
    • This dysfunction potentially reveals a prelexical processing level with altered letter weighting by position.
    • Experimental conditions limiting lexical access in normal readers mimicked aspects of CP's performance.
